Anal warts (condyloma) are warts in and around your anus. They’re caused by human papilloma virus (HPV), which is spread through sexual or skin-to-skin contact. Symptoms include itching, bleeding or feeling a lump in your anus. Type 1 Excludes. specified type of rash- code to condition.Etiology of Pruritus Ani. Most anal itching is. Idiopathic (the majority) Hygiene-related. Too little cleansing leaves irritating stool and sweat residue on the anal skin. Perianal cellulitis, also known as perianitis or perianal streptococcal dermatitis, is a bacterial infection affecting the lower layers of the skin around the anus. It presents as bright redness in the skin and can be accompanied by pain, difficulty defecating, itching, and bleeding. General information. Anal (perianal, hemorrhoidal) skin tag in most cases do not have a bright clinical picture, are considered not a disease, but a cosmetic defect. They are equally often observed in men and women, usually appear after 25-30 years. What is anal itching?Pilonidal disease is a chronic skin infection in the crease of the buttocks near the coccyx (tailbone). It affects about 70,000 people in the US annually and is more common in men than women. Most often it occurs between puberty and age 40.
